On Mon, Aug 12, 2019 at 02:50:45PM -0700, Nick Desaulniers wrote:
GCC unescapes escaped string section names while Clang does not. Because
__section uses the `#` stringification operator for the section name, it
doesn't need to be escaped.

This antipattern was found with:
$ grep -e __section\(\" -e __section__\(\" -r
